    GENERAL SUMMARY: Performs application and removal of various paint coatings on ships and non-nuclear components, interior/exterior surface ships preservation per NAVSEA Standard Item (009-32).

    LOCATION: Norfolk, VA

    DUTIES and RESPONSIBILITIES:

    • Properly handle and utilize hazardous materials/solvents, including but not limited to, toxic and non-toxic painting materials, select proper protection required when applying, removing, and properly disposing of hazardous waste generated.
    • Apply and remove various paint coatings on ships and non-nuclear components, interior/exterior surface ships preservation per NAVSEA Standard Item (009-32).
    • Prepare and mask surfaces for preservation.
    • Ensure general housekeeping (GHK) is accomplished as needed per shift.

    EDUCATION:

    • Must be a graduate with a high school diploma or GED equivalence.

    REQUIREMENTS:

    • Minimum of two years of experience in marine coatings and/or combination of marine and industrial coatings field. C12, C7, C14 or NBPI certification preferred.
    • Must have the ability to carry out written or oral instructions and analytical skills to resolve issues.
    • Must be able to use all abrasive blasts systems, spray booth, air compressor, forklifts, man lifts boom type and scissor and some Q.C. test instruments.
    • Must be able to work effectively with others.
    • Must be steady, reliable worker
